"My daughter is 3.5 years old. Which vaccines should she still receive?"

A. at this age only annual flu vaccine needs to be given vaccine is very important to increase the immunity of the body. very important to complete the course of vaccination which come before 5 years of age because this is the age group in which children are prone to vaccine preventable diseases. contact your doctor who will tell you which vaccines are important for your child and which vaccines are optional. optional vaccine only depends upon the immunity status of the child as well as upon the endemic diseases of your area
